The electronic signature market is dominated by two American companies: DocuSign (US, publicly traded) and Adobe Sign (US, part of Adobe). Together, they control the majority of global e-signature revenue. European businesses use them because they are ubiquitous, well-integrated, and familiar. But there is a structural problem: both companies process data through US infrastructure by default, creating GDPR transfer concerns that European legal and compliance teams increasingly refuse to ignore.
Yousign was built to serve the market that this structural problem creates. Founded in 2013 in France, Yousign SAS is a European e-signature platform that stores all data exclusively in France, supports all eIDAS signature levels (SES, AES, QES), and provides a developer-friendly API that enables deep integration into business workflows. Over 15,000 European businesses have adopted the platform, and the company has grown to over 200 employees.
The proposition is clear: if you need electronic signatures that are legally binding across the EU, stored on European soil, and backed by an eIDAS-certified trust infrastructure, Yousign is purpose-built for that requirement. It does not attempt to match DocuSign's global integration marketplace or Adobe's creative suite synergies. Instead, it focuses on doing European e-signatures exceptionally well β with the compliance depth, API quality, and signing experience to back that claim.
Yousign supports Simple Electronic Signatures (SES) for everyday documents, Advanced Electronic Signatures (AES) for higher-assurance contracts, and Qualified Electronic Signatures (QES) through partnerships with qualified trust service providers. Under eIDAS regulation, these signatures are legally binding across all 27 EU member states, with QES carrying the same legal weight as a handwritten signature.
The practical impact: a contract signed through Yousign in Paris is legally enforceable in Berlin, Madrid, and Amsterdam without additional validation. For businesses operating across EU borders, this cross-jurisdictional validity eliminates a genuine compliance headache.
Yousign's REST API is comprehensive and well-documented β consistently cited by developers as one of the best in the e-signature category. The API enables signature workflow automation, embedded signing experiences via iframe or SDK, webhook notifications for real-time status updates, and programmatic document template management. API access is available from the Pro tier onward.
For SaaS companies embedding signatures into their products (HR platforms, legal tech, contract management), the API quality is a decisive factor. Yousign's developer documentation includes detailed guides, code examples, and sandbox environments for testing. The embedded signing component allows the entire signing experience to occur within your application's interface β no redirect to Yousign's website required.
Yousign provides configurable signing workflows with defined signing order, approval steps before signature requests, automatic reminders, and expiration dates. Document templates with reusable signature fields accelerate the preparation of recurring documents β employment contracts, NDAs, service agreements. Bulk sending handles high-volume scenarios where hundreds of documents require signatures.
The signing experience can be branded with your company's logo, colours, and custom email templates. For client-facing signing β proposals, contracts, onboarding documents β branded pages project professionalism and consistency. The branding applies to signature invitation emails, the signing page itself, and completion notifications.
Every signature event generates a timestamped, tamper-proof audit trail recording who signed, when, from which IP address, and with which authentication method. Signed documents are archived with the audit trail attached, providing the evidentiary record needed for dispute resolution or regulatory audit. The archiving is included in all plans.
Yousign does not offer a free tier β only a 14-day trial. The One plan at approximately EUR 15 per month provides SES signatures, up to five documents per month, one user, and email support. The Plus plan at approximately EUR 25 per month adds AES signatures, unlimited documents, up to five users, templates, and custom branding. The Pro plan at approximately EUR 45 per month unlocks all signature levels including QES, unlimited users, API access, and approval workflows.
Enterprise pricing is custom and includes dedicated account management, SSO with SAML, advanced compliance features, and custom integrations.
The pricing is competitive β meaningfully below DocuSign's equivalent tiers and with the added assurance of French data hosting. The lack of a free tier is a limitation for individuals or small businesses with minimal signing needs, but the 14-day trial is sufficient to evaluate the platform. The per-plan pricing (not per-user on higher tiers) provides cost predictability that per-signature pricing models lack.
For the Pro plan specifically, the combination of unlimited users, API access, and all signature levels at EUR 45 per month represents strong value for growing businesses.
This is Yousign's structural advantage. All data is hosted exclusively in France, in data centres operated under strict EU data protection standards. The company is a French SAS (simplified joint-stock company) under French jurisdiction. eIDAS compliance is independently verified through partnerships with qualified trust service providers.
For organisations subject to French data protection requirements, working with French government entities, or serving French enterprise clients with contractual data residency clauses, Yousign satisfies the strictest interpretation of data sovereignty.
The combination of French data hosting, eIDAS certification, and GDPR compliance earns Yousign an EU compliance rating of 9.5 β the highest available in the e-signature category, tied with Skribble.

Yousign is the e-signature platform that European compliance teams wish DocuSign were. The French data hosting, eIDAS certification across all signature levels, and developer-friendly API combine to create a product that is genuinely purpose-built for European business requirements. The lack of a free tier and the smaller integration ecosystem compared to DocuSign are real limitations. But at EUR 45 per month for the Pro plan with unlimited users, API access, and all signature levels, the value proposition is strong. For organisations where data sovereignty is a requirement rather than a preference, Yousign delivers the compliance depth that American competitors structurally cannot match.
